大兼职网站的建设(源码)

用户长期使用之前的基于C/S的管理系统对大学生兼职信息进行管理,其操作流程比较繁琐。并且传统的管理流程存在着很多缺点第一点,完成各类信息登记、更新等业务流程的效率低下,第二点,处理能力比较低,第三点,在同一时刻,对能提供服务的人员个数是一定的。针对上述诸多的缺点,研究了一种在互联网上的兼职管理系统,基于B/S的处理好上述问题,使其能够快速的进行信息的检索以及信息的管理,同时许可用户使用更方便、有效、实时的大学生兼职网站。我所开发的大学生兼职网站使用的开发工具是Myeclipse,使用JAVA语言,处理后台数据的软件是MYSQL,采用B/S模式。系统的使用者为用户和系统管理员。用户和系统管理员相互搭配,完成系统功能的实现。能够完成大学生兼职信息管理操作,包括多个部分兼职信息登记、修改和查询管理。关键词 兼职,管理系统,计算机,开发
目 录
1 引言 1
1.1 课题背景 1
1.2 课题意义 1
1.3 课题研究现状 1
1.4 课题研究内容 2
2 相关技术 2
2.1 JSP技术介绍 2
2.2 系统编程语言 2
2.3 系统结构(B/S) 2
2.4 MYSQL数据库简介 3
3 系统分析 3
3.1 可行性分析 3
3.2 系统需求分析 4
4 系统设计 6
4.1 主要设计 6
4.2 数据表设计 10
4.4 系统开发及运行环境 14
5 系统实现 15
5.1 网站首页实现 15
5.2 用户登录实现 15
5.3 用户密码管理实现 16
5.4 用户信息管理实现 17
5.5 工作分类管理模块实现 19
5.6 就业新闻管理模块实现 19
5.7 招聘信息管理模块实现 20
6 系统测试 22
6.1 用户注册测试 22
6.2 用户登录测试 22
6.3 招聘信息发布测试 23
6.4后台管 *好棒文|www.hbsrm.com +Q: ¥351916072¥ 
理登录测试 24
6.5 后台管理测试 25
6.6 软件需求测试结论 27
结 论 28
致 谢 29
参 考 文 献 30
1 引言
早些年前,用人单位都是通过电视宣传,讲座宣传以及广告张贴等方式进行招聘活动。随着技术的进步,以往的招聘方式已经很少见了。目前用的最多的是网络招聘,企业发布招聘信息后,就能实时地得到反馈,并且能够择优录取。同样网络招聘,也极大地方便了求职者。招聘平台,成为了招聘单位与求职者联系的桥梁。招聘平台有多种样式,本文主要研究的是一种采用B/S结构的网页版招聘平台。
1.1 课题背景
现如今,很多兼职网站,开发目的就是为了赚钱。对于普通的在校大学生来说,网页中许多功能并没有运用的到,造成了资源的浪费。同时网站做的也比较繁琐,操作起来不太方便。兼职网站中的公司信息审核以及招聘信息审核也不到位,潜在的威胁了大学生的安全。在这样的背景下,开发一个功能完整,易于操作,同时保障大学生安全的兼职网站,迫在眉睫。
1.2 课题意义
每年,毕业生的数量都会较上一年有着大量的增加,然而就业岗位与毕业生数量并不是等量增加。同时在学校生活中,不少同学利用课余时间兼职,获得的劳动报酬用于减轻父母的负担以及得到自己心仪的东西。在这样的情况下,他们急需一个网站平台,能够方便他们找到自己的工作,创造自己的价值。不少中介网站都是以盈利为目的,同时网站上管理比较繁琐,不能够进行快捷高效的管理。为了解决上述问题,本文研究了一种采用B/S结构,在网页上进行操作的兼职平台,此平台能够为用户提供快捷的信息查询服务以及信息的管理服务,让用户使用起来得心应手。
1.3 课题研究现状
现如今国内外都存在着大量的中介网站,然而这些网站并不是所有的项目都免费的向使用者提供。因此大学生在使用此网站寻找工作的同时,需要向网站支付一定的费用,用来获得更多的招聘岗位,为自己寻得更多的兼职工作。付出并不是永远都有回报,同样,大学生为寻找更多就业机会,付出的金钱很多情况下都是竹篮打水一场空。网站的更多就业机会,并不能保证你一定能够找到工作。同时,在利益的驱动下,不少中介网站为一些在工商部门没有登记且对学生得不到保障的企业进行推广,不少同学由于社会经验不足,缺乏判断能力,前往这些企业进行工作,但是最后,这些企业往往以各种理由推辞发放工资,严重的话,还会伴随着暴力的发生,对学生身心造成伤害。发现问题才能解决问题,一个安全有保障,并且免费提供服务的兼职网站急需建立。
1.4 课题研究内容
此大学生兼职网站为大学生寻找兼职而开发,其中包括前台和后台。前台主要有招聘信息的浏览以及就业资讯的浏览,后台包括招聘信息的发布,修改,以及删除。本课题的研究的关键问题在于如何处理好网站管理员,招聘单位,兼职人员三者之间的关系,实现模块之间的衔接以及对数据库的管理。
2 相关技术
2.1 JSP技术介绍
JSP的主要用途就是实现利用Java语言编写的Web程序中的用户界面。Jsp的主要工作方式是,通过网页表单的形式,获取到用户输入信息,再与数据库进行比对,比对通过后,实现页面的创建。Jsp的标签具有功能多样性的特征,它的功能有对数据库进行访问,对用户选择信息进行记录,同时在网页的共享以及传递信息方便扮演着极其重要的角色。JSP的常见作用域为page,Request,session,application。JSP的9大内置对象为request,reponse,session,out,page,application,exception,pagecontext,config。
2.2 系统编程语言
Java不但是一种开发语言,而且还是一个平台。Java既可以编译,又可以被解释。在编译器的帮助下,我们可以将Java语言转换为中间代码。通过运用解释器,可以将Java字节分析到每一节,与此同时,在计算机上也可以被运行。一次编译,永久解释执行。Java语言拥有着自己的特征,它的简单性,适用性,功能强大性,安全性,使得程序员对Java语言更加青睐。

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/jsjkxyjs/1526.html

好棒文